excel表格自动隐藏行

当前位置: 钓虾网 > 说说 > excel表格自动隐藏行

excel表格自动隐藏行

2025-01-21 作者:钓虾网 3

钓虾网今天给大家分享《excel表格自动隐藏行》,钓虾网小编对内容进行了深度展开编辑,希望通过本文能为您带来解惑。

在 Excel 中,您可以使用以下几种方法来自动隐藏行:

1. 使用筛选功能:

这是最简单的方法,适用于想要根据特定条件隐藏行的情况。例如,如果您只想查看销售额超过 10,000 元的订单,则可以使用筛选功能隐藏销售额低于此值的订单行。操作步骤如下:

- 选择要筛选的数据区域。

- 点击“数据”选项卡,然后点击“筛选”。

- 点击列标题中的下拉箭头,然后选择要筛选的值。

- 取消勾选要隐藏的值,然后点击“确定”。

2. 使用“分组”功能:

如果您想根据特定列的值对行进行分组,并能够展开或折叠每个组,则可以使用“分组”功能。例如,如果您有一个包含所有员工及其部门列表的工作表,则可以按部门对行进行分组,并隐藏不感兴趣的部门的详细信息。操作步骤如下:

- 选择要分组的数据区域。

- 点击“数据”选项卡,然后点击“分组”。

- 在弹出的“分组”对话框中,选择要分组的级别,然后点击“确定”。

- 点击工作表左侧的加号 (+) 或减号 (-) 按钮以展开或折叠组。

3. 使用 VBA 代码:

对于更复杂的情况,您可以使用 VBA 代码来自动隐藏行。例如,您可以编写一个宏,根据单元格的值自动隐藏或显示行。以下是一个简单的 VBA 代码示例,可以根据 A 列中单元格的值隐藏或显示行:

```vba

Private Sub Worksheet_Change(ByVal Target As Range)

Dim i As Long

If Target.Column = 1 Then

For i = 2 To LastRow(ActiveSheet)

If Cells(i, 1).Value = "隐藏" Then

Row

excel表格自动隐藏行

s(i).Hidden =

excel表格自动隐藏行

True

Else

Rows(i).Hidden = False

End If

Next i

End If

End Sub

```

将此代码粘贴到工作表的代码模块中,然后保存工作簿。现在,每当 A 列中单元格的值更改为“隐藏”时,该行就会自动隐藏。钓虾网小编提醒您,请注意,VBA 代码可能会带来安全风险,因此请谨慎使用。

有关《excel表格自动隐藏行》的内容介绍到这里,想要了解更多相关内容记得收藏关注本站。

文章来自《钓虾网小编|www.jnqjk.cn》整理于网络,文章内容不代表本站立场,转载请注明出处。

本文链接:https://www.jnqjk.cn/weim/137550.html

AI推荐

Copyright 2024 © 钓虾网 XML 币安app官网

蜀ICP备2022021333号-1